Ventilation and clearance needs

Integrated units generally require specific top and/or rear ventilation to allow heat to dissipate from the compressor area. You should follow the installation manual or seller guidance carefully.

Inadequate ventilation can increase energy use and shorten the unit’s life, so leave the recommended space rather than forcing a tight fit.

Setup and first use recommendations

When the unit arrives, you’ll want to take a few simple steps before loading it with food. Proper setup ensures optimal performance and longevity.

You’ll appreciate the difference in performance and silence if you follow these initial setup tasks.

Step-by-step start-up guide

  1. Inspect the unit for shipping damage; report any issues immediately.
  2. Let the appliance sit upright for a few hours if it was transported on its side.
  3. Install according to the manufacturer’s ventilation and leveling instructions.
  4. Power on and let it run empty for a few hours to reach stable temperatures.
  5. Load items gradually once the fridge/freezer achieves the recommended temperatures.

These steps help avoid compressor stress and ensure consistent cooling from day one.

Troubleshooting common issues

Even well-built units can encounter issues. Knowing basic troubleshooting helps you decide when to call support versus resolving minor issues yourself.

You’ll avoid unnecessary service calls by trying simple fixes first.

Quick fixes you can try

  • If it’s noisy, verify it’s level and not touching cabinetry.
  • If temperatures are off, ensure vents inside the fridge/freezer aren’t blocked by items.
  • If doors don’t seal properly, check for misalignment or debris on the gasket.

If problems persist after these checks, gather model information and contact the seller or manufacturer for support.
